Sourced directly from the Instagram Stories and Posts of @codatoronto, this playlist brings the authentic vibes of CODA Toronto—a legendary venue at 794 Bathurst St known for its deep roots in house, techno, and tech house. Since its inception in 2014, CODA has been a beacon for nightlife enthusiasts, succeeding the iconic Footwork club and earning accolades like 'Best Venue North' by DJ Mag in 2018.
